1

Тема: Ошибка при импорте базы данных Table doesn't exist

Здравствуйте!
Помогите, пожалуйста, разобраться с такой проблемой:
На хостинге beget.ru захожу в phpmyadmin.
Создала новую пустую базу данных dotrip_kos
Открываю импорт и загружаю файл sql с базой данных.
Выход ошибка: #1146 - Table 'dotrip_kos.SS_products' doesn't exist

То есть таблица не существует. Но я ведь делаю импорт в пустую базу данных, разве таблицы не должны при импорте создаваться?

Спасибо.
С уважением, Мария

2

Re: Ошибка при импорте базы данных Table doesn't exist

Структуры таблиц должны создаваться, если при сохранении не выбрано иное. В вашем случае видно, что в sql файле есть только данные, но нет структуры таблицы.

3

Re: Ошибка при импорте базы данных Table doesn't exist

Hanut сказал:

Структуры таблиц должны создаваться, если при сохранении не выбрано иное. В вашем случае видно, что в sql файле есть только данные, но нет структуры таблицы.

Спасибо за ответ.
Но у меня не получается сделать импорт той базы данных, которую я только что экспортировала из phpmyadmin.
Выходит эта же ошибка.
Разве это нормально, что БД после экпорта из phpmyadmin не могла туда обратно импортироваться?

4

Re: Ошибка при импорте базы данных Table doesn't exist

usulla сказал:

Но у меня не получается сделать импорт той базы данных, которую я только что экспортировала из phpmyadmin.

Если при экспорте вы ничего в настройках не трогали, то в sql файле должна сохраниться структура выбранных таблиц. Откройте .sql файл текстовым редактором и посмотрите есть ли там структуры таблиц (запросы CREATE TABLE).